In the parable of the Pharisee and the tax collector, Jesus addresses those who pride themselves on their own righteousness and look down on others. He contrasts the self-righteous prayer of a Pharisee, who thanks God that he is not like other sinners and boasts of his religious practices, with the humble plea of a tax collector, who acknowledges his sinfulness and begs for mercy. The shocking twist is that the tax collector, not the Pharisee, leaves the temple justified. This parable teaches profound lessons: religious activities can be deceptive, pride is dangerous, and our perception of others is shaped by our self-awareness. Ultimately, eternal life is granted through humility and repentance, as demonstrated by the tax collector.
